The Rotary Club of Westborough will collect recyclable plastics during its 11th Trex Plastic Film Recycling Challenge. The volunteer event takes place this Saturday, May 22 from 8:00 to 9:00 a.m. at the rear of Kohl's retail store in Northborough.

During our May 8 drive, we collected 304 pounds of film plastics. Since we started last November, our cumulative total is 1,908 pounds of this material, which would otherwise have ended in landfillswater bodies and/or oceans. So far, we have collected nearly four times our original goal of 500 pounds.

This will be our last collection before we take a summer recess. We will resume the collection drives after Labor Day weekend
Our plan is to keep the biweekly schedule, and run the events during the following periods - for as long as sustainable:
  • Weekend after Labor Day to weekend before Thanksgiving Day.
  • Weekend after Martin Luther King Jr. Holiday to before Memorial Day.
This is because the winter holiday season is a busy period for Kohls’ - and summer provides a break for our volunteers.
